Toronto, Ontario--(Newsfile Corp. - February 10, 2025) - Safe Supply Streaming Co Ltd. (CSE: SPLY) (FSE: QM4) (OTCQB: SSPLF) ("Safe Supply" or the "Company") and Safety Strips Tech Corp., a private company ("SSTC" or "Safety Strips") are pleased to announce that they have entered into a business combination agreement dated February 10, 2025, (the "Business Combination Agreement") pursuant to which Safe Supply will acquire the remaining 94.31% of the issued and outstanding common shares of Safety Strips (the "Transaction"). Under the Transaction, Safety Strips shareholders will receive 1.2748 Safe Supply common shares for each Safety Strips common share held (the "Exchange Ratio"). The Transaction will be effected by way of a three-cornered amalgamation under the Business Corporations Act (British Columbia).

The Company is also pleased to announce the appointment of Raf Souccar as a new director of the Company's board effective February 10, 2025. In addition to his appointment, Mr. Souccar has entered into a consulting agreement with the Company on January 14, 2025 (the "Consulting Agreement"). Pursuant to the Consulting Agreement, Mr. Souccar will provide consulting services in relation to his expertise in governance and strategic advisory, playing a key role in shaping Safe Supply's corporate strategy and ensuring strong governance practices. His experience in national security, policy, and organizational leadership will be invaluable as the Company continue to expand and strengthen their position in the industry.

Mr. Souccar served as Deputy Commissioner of Federal and International Policing in the Royal Canadian Mounted Police (RCMP). In addition to his responsibilities for National Security and Organized Crime, Raf also had oversight of the RCMP's role in Canada's Drug Strategy and has provided testimony before Parliamentary Committees relative to the opioid crisis and ways to deal with the issue of substance abuse disorder.

After counseling successive justice ministers on the topic of marijuana legalization, Prime Minister Justin Trudeau appointed Mr. Souccar to the nine member Marijuana Legalization Task Force in 2016. The Task Force was given a mandate to consult and provide advice to the Government of Canada on the design of a new legislative and regulatory framework for legal access to cannabis.

Mr. Souccar has a Bachelor of Business Administration and has been a lawyer and member of the Law Society of Ontario since 1995. He's also a graduate of the University of Toronto Institute of Corporate Directors.

About the Transaction

The consummation of the Transaction is subject to a number of conditions customary to transactions of this nature, including, among others, the approval of Safety Strip's shareholders approving the amalgamation contemplated in the Business Combination Agreement. Safety Strips expects to receive shareholder approval via written resolution to consider and approve the Transaction as soon as possible. If approved, the Transaction is expected to close shortly thereafter, subject to the receipt of the approval of the Canadian Securities Exchange.

Further details regarding the terms and conditions of the Transaction are set out in the Business Combination Agreement, dated February 10, 2025, which will be publicly filed by the Company under its profile at www.sedarplus.ca.

There are 58,048,300 Safety Strips common shares currently issued and outstanding, in exchange for which 74,000,000 Safe Supply common shares ("Consideration Shares") shall be issued to Safety Strips shareholders under the Business Combination Agreement. The Consideration Shares are being issued at a deemed price of $0.06 per Consideration Share and have a deemed aggregate value of $4,440,000. The Consideration Shares are subject to contractual resale restrictions, in accordance with which of the Consideration Shares will be released from lock-up on the later of: (i) the filing date of a Form 51-102F4 - Business Acquisition Report ("BAR") in respect of the Transaction; or (ii) one-third of the Consideration Shares will be released from lock-up following the four, eight and twelve months periods after the Transaction close.

In connection with the Transaction, the Company has agreed to issue 3,700,000 finder fee common shares (the "FFS") to ArcStone Ventures Inc. (the "Finder") as compensation for facilitating the introduction of the Company to Safety Strips. The FFS will be issued to the Finder at the closing of the Transaction.

Within 75 days following closing, the Company will file a BAR, which will include details of the Transaction and audited financial statements for SSTC.

Debt Settlement

On February 9, 2025, the Company entered into certain debt conversion agreements with various creditors (collectively the "Debt Conversion Agreements") to settle $90,120 of debt (the "Debt Settlement"). The Company and its officers have determined that to preserve the Company's cash, they intend to settle the Debt Settlement through the issuance of 1,502,000 shares at a deemed price of $0.06 per Safe Supply common share pursuant to the terms of the Debt Conversion Agreements. The Debt Settlement is subject to the Company obtaining all necessary corporate and regulatory approvals, including approval of the Canadian Securities Exchange (the "CSE"). The shares issued for the Debt Settlement are not subject to a hold under the policies of the CSE and applicable securities laws.

Related Party Transaction

The Transaction constitutes a "related party transaction", as such term is defined in Multilateral Instrument 61-101 – Protection of Minority Shareholders in Special Transactions ("MI 61-101") as Jordan Greenberg, the Chief Financial Officer, of the Company (the "Greenberg Party") holds 2,160,000 Safety Strips common shares and Raf Souccar, a director of the Company (the "Souccar Party"; together with the Greenberg Party, the "Related Parties") holds 784,440 Safety Strips common shares. Following the completion of the Transaction, the Greenberg Party will receive 2,753,569 Safe Supply common shares and the Souccar Party will receive 1,000,004 Safe Supply common shares in exchange for their Safety Strips common shares held. The Company relied on exemptions from the valuation and minority shareholder approval requirements of MI 61-101 contained in sections 5.5(a) and 5.7(1)(a) of MI 61-101, as the fair market value of the Safe Supply common shares held by the Related Parties does not exceed 25% of the market capitalization of the Company, as determined in accordance with MI 61-101.

The Debt Settlement constitutes a "related party transaction", as such term is defined in MI 61-101 due to the involvement of the Greenberg Party, who is an officer of the Company and would require the Company to receive minority shareholder approval for, and obtain a formal valuation for the subject matter of, the transaction in accordance with MI 61-101, prior to the completion of such transaction. However, in completing the Debt Settlement, the Company intends to rely on exemptions from the valuation and minority shareholder approval requirements of MI 61-101 contained in sections 5.5(a) and 5.7(1)(a) of MI 61-101, as the fair market value of the Greenberg Party's participation in the Debt Settlement does not and will not exceed 25% of the market capitalization of the Company, as determined in accordance with MI 61-101.
